Lanlivery Primary Academy Catchment Area Information

What is the catchment area for Lanlivery Primary Academy?

The catchment area for Lanlivery Primary Academy is the geographic zone Cornwall uses to prioritise admissions when this primary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and siblings. Cornwall publ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

As an academy, Lanlivery Primary Academy sets its own admissions criteria, agreed with Cornwall. The catchment area boundary is defined in the school's annual admissions policy, which may differ from the LA's general school admissions arrangements.

The official admissions policy, including the catchment boundary map, is published by Cornwall before each admissions cycle. Always verify your address with the council before submitting an application, as boundaries can change year to year.

Lanlivery Primary Academy: 70 places, 80% filled: places available

Lanlivery Primary Academy has a published admission number of 70 places. 56 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 80%. At 80% full, the school currently has headroom below its 70 place limit. Catchment distance criteria still apply when the school is oversubscribed, but at current demand levels, places have been available for applicants outside the immediate catchment area.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 12%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, below the national average. The school draws primarily from a lower-deprivation part of Bodmin.
